Block 1,038,886
Block Hash
78adf7336b8a5b28f19839dfa9371cae4194b8c3dac162609ea980b383
086449
Previous Block Hash
00db5202cba538455449ea984a9655cd098ab71e807652d364e986efbb 71bde6
Mined
Transactions
4
Difficulty
27.50 M
Size
848 bytes
Transactions (4)
1 input, 1 output
10,000.00678
PEPE
1 input, 2 outputs
8,261.35049705
PEPE
1 input, 2 outputs
127,411.26339605
PEPE
1 input, 2 outputs
104,977.584
PEPE